What are the types of air compressor?

Air compressor is a device that converts mechanical energy into air pressure. According to its working principle, structure form, lubrication mode, performance characteristics, use and type of various classification standards, air compressors can be divided into various types. The following is a summary of the main types of air compressors:

1. classified by working principle

  1. volumetric air compressor:

    • piston air compressor: The air is compressed by the reciprocating movement of the piston in the cylinder. The structure is relatively simple, but the operation is not stable and it is easy to wear.
    • Screw air compressor: Compressed air through the mutual meshing of yin and yang rotors, compact structure, high efficiency, high reliability, widely used in industrial production.
    • Sliding vane air compressor: Rotary variable capacity compressor, its axial sliding vane slides radially on the eccentric rotor of the same cylindrical cylinder block to realize gas compression.
    • Scroll air compressor: A plurality of compression chambers are formed by the meshing of the fixed scroll and the movable scroll, and the air is compressed by the spiral blades, which has a simple structure and low noise.
    • Liquid-piston air compressor: Use water or other liquid as a piston to compress gas.
    • Roots double-rotor air compressor: Compressed gas by the intermeshing of two Roots rotors.
  2. Power type (speed type or turbine type) air compressor:

    • centrifugal air compressor: The high-speed rotating impeller accelerates the gas, thereby converting the speed energy into pressure, with large flow and compact structure. It is suitable for large-scale industrial production and occasions that require high-pressure air.
    • axial flow air compressor: The gas is accelerated by the rotor equipped with blades, the main air flow is axial, the flow is large, and the efficiency is high.
    • Mixed flow air compressor: Combine the characteristics of centrifugal and axial air compressors.
    • jet air compressor: Use high-speed gas or steam jet to take away the inhaled gas, and then convert the velocity of the mixed gas into pressure on the diffuser.
  3. Thermal air compressor: Gas compression through the thermal process, this type of air compressor is rarely used in industrial production.

2. classified by lubrication method

  • oil-free air compressor: There is no need to add lubricating oil during operation, which is suitable for occasions with high requirements for compressed air purity.
  • Oil-lubricated air compressor: It needs to be lubricated by splash or forced (I. e. oil lubrication provided by oil pump and oil injector).

3. classified by performance characteristics

  • low noise air compressor: Designed with noise reduction measures, suitable for occasions with high noise requirements.
  • Variable frequency air compressor: It can adjust the speed and power according to the fluctuation of gas consumption to realize energy-saving operation.
  • Explosion-proof air compressor: With explosion-proof performance, suitable for flammable and explosive places.

Classification of 4. by use

air compressors are widely used in various fields, such as refrigerators, air conditioners, refrigeration, oil fields, natural gas filling stations, rock drills, pneumatic tools, vehicle brakes, door and window opening and closing, textile machinery, tire inflation, plastic machinery, mines, ships, Medical treatment, sandblasting and painting, etc.

Classification of 5. by type

  • stationary air compressor: Usually installed in a fixed position, suitable for long-term operation.
  • Mobile air compressor: It has the characteristics of easy movement and transportation, and is suitable for occasions that require frequent changes of work locations.
  • Closed air compressor: With a sealed casing, it can reduce noise and pollutant emissions.

In summary, there are many types of air compressors, and users should consider comprehensively according to actual needs and use environment when choosing.
